components/freshsales/common/utils.mjs (1)

1-4: The regex pattern may not handle all edge cases correctly.

The current regex ^_*(.)|_+(.)/g doesn't properly handle consecutive underscores or leading underscores in all scenarios. For example, "__test_case" would become "Test case" (missing the first character), and "_test__case" might not format correctly.

Consider this more robust implementation:

-export const snakeCaseToTitleCase = (s) =>
-  s.replace(/^_*(.)|_+(.)/g, (s, c, d) => c
-    ? c.toUpperCase()
-    : " " + d.toUpperCase());
+export const snakeCaseToTitleCase = (s) =>
+  s.replace(/^_+/, '')
+    .replace(/_+/g, ' ')
+    .replace(/\b\w/g, (c) => c.toUpperCase());
components/freshsales/freshsales.app.mjs (1)

143-168: Good pagination implementation with minor optimization opportunity.

The pagination logic is well-structured. However, there's a minor issue with the hasMore logic - it should check if there are more pages available rather than just if the current page has data.

Consider improving the pagination termination condition:

-        hasMore = data[responseField].length;
+        hasMore = data[responseField].length > 0 && data[responseField].length === (params.per_page || 25);

This assumes the API uses a per_page parameter and stops when fewer results are returned than requested.

🛠️ Refactor suggestion

Add error handling for missing filter.

The code assumes a filter with the specified name exists, but doesn't handle the case where it might not be found.

Add error handling:

-      return filters.find((filter) => filter.name === name).id;
+      const filter = filters.find((filter) => filter.name === name);
+      if (!filter) {
+        throw new Error(`Filter with name "${name}" not found for model "${model}"`);
+      }
+      return filter.id;
